  • a decurling device for rolled copy paper wherein a paper pressing roller which presses copy paper drawn from a copy paper roll against a decurling roller is journaled at a fixed location at a lower part of a paper mounting bracket, the paper pressing roller being separated from the decurling roller when the bracket is tilted downwardly to mount a roll of copy paper thereon, whereby difiiculty in the loading of the printing paper caused by the mounting of the decurling roller, which bends the path of the copy paper, is avoided.
  • This invention relates to a device for decurling copy paper drawn from a copy paper roll in a copier and to a device to cut the paper in designated lengths.

  • Reference number 1 denotes a base plate of the copier.
  • 2 denotes a top plane.
  • 3 denotes a cover which is freely removable from the side of the box type copier.
  • 4 denotes a partition plate fixed to said base plate 1.
  • a well-known charging device and an exposure device may be provided in the case of an electrostatic copier, or an exposure device may be provided in the case of another copier.
  • a mounting bracket 6 for a copy paper roll 5 is mounted at a pair of side plates of the copier facing each other (not 3,501,375 Patented Mar. 17, 1970 shown in the figures) by means of a shaft 7 so that said bracket 6 may be freely moved up and down.
  • Said mounting bracket 6 comprises a pair of side plates 6a and 6b and a guide plate 8 with said side plates 6a and 6b fixed onto both sides.
  • a paper pressing roller 9 is journaled for rotation at a fixed location at a lower part of said bracket 6.
  • Notches 10a and 10b at the upper ends of both side plates serve to mount a spindle 5a of the paper roll 5.
  • a knob or handle 11 is provided on the side plate 6b .
  • the mounting bracket 6, when placed at the stationary position shown in FIG. 1, is prevented from undergoing clockwise rotation around the shaft 7 by engagement of the side plate 6b against a stopper (not shown in the drawing).
  • a roller 12 which is far smaller in diameter than a core 5b for the copy paper is provided near the paper pressing roller 9.
  • the copy paper drawn from the paper roll moves while pressed against the circumference of the roller 12 by the pressing roller 9 and thereby the curl caused in the copy paper roll is removed.
  • Reference numbers 13 and 14 denote feed rollers which advance the copy paper forward.
  • 16 denotes a release lever on which said feed roller 14 is journaled and the lower edge 16a is positioned above a projecting shaft 9a of the pressing roller 9.
  • 15 denotes a shaft of the release lever 16.
  • 17 denotes a fixed knife blade.
  • 18 denotes a mOVable knife blade which cuts the copy paper drawn out of the copy paper roll in designated lengths, by cooperating with the fixed knife blade 17.
  • 19 and 20 denote rollers which feed the copy paper through a slit 4a into the exposure device or the charging device.
  • the mounting bracket 6 When the copy paper roll 5 is replaced or when a new copy paper roll 5 is mounted, as indicated in FIG. 2, the mounting bracket 6 is rotated on the shaft 7 after removing the cover.
  • the guide plate 8 When the mounting bracket 6 is rotated, the guide plate 8 is made horizontal and at the same time the paper pressing roller 9 moves obliquely upward away from the decurling roller 12, so that the copy paper 5a drawn out of the paper roll may be inserted straight into the gap between the feed rollers 13 and 14.
  • the mounting bracket 6 is inclined to the mounting position as shown in FIG. 2, the lower edge 16a of the release lever 16 is pushed up by projecting shaft 9a and thereby the feed roller 14 is separated from the roller 13.
  • a device for decurling rolled copy paper comprising a paper mounting bracket movable between a mounting position in which a roll of paper can be mounted thereon and an operative position in which paper is drawn from the roll, a paper pressing roller journaled on said paper mounting bracket, and a decurling roller having a diameter smaller than that of the core of the copy paper roll; said paper pressing roller pressing copy paper drawn from the copy paper roll against said decurling roller so that said copy paper may be decurled, said paper pressing roller being separated from said decurling roller when said paper mounting bracket is moved to said mounting position.
  • a device for decurling rolled copy paper as claimed in claim 1, comprising a guide plate on said bracket movable therewith to a position where the leading edge of the copy paper is guided by the guide plate for insertion between the pressing and decurling rollers.
